Harrogate International Festivals feature the best international acts on the classical music scene today.

The performances are usually held in the Old Swan Hotel’s ballroom.

Booking Information
Tickets can be booked through the Harrogate International Festivals Office: 01423 562 303 or Online at www.harrogateinternationalfestivals.com (or pop into the office on Raglan Street).
